Solar Pool Heating - Energy of the Sun
How Does Solar Pool Heater Function? Energy from the sun is the solar energy and it is just another fuel to heat the pool. The water that is circulated through the filter using the pump is automatically diverted so that it flows through the many small passages of solar collector. Water is heated by the sun when passed through the collector. The water then flows back directly into the pool. In this operation, the water goes from pool to pump, from pump to filter, from filter to collectors and then into the pool. When the water in the pool has reached the desired temperature the water bypasses the solar collector and returns to the pool. It is recommended that the solar collectors be placed where maximum amount of sun rays fall during the day. Solar Heater Collectors While choosing a collector, get an unglazed one as this collector delivers heat more effectively to the pool than the covered collectors. Moreover, uncovered collectors are less expensive when compared to the covered collectors. Solar pool heater requires not much of maintenance beyond the usual pool winterizing procedures. The operating cost of the solar heater is almost zero as the energy from the sun is free. The cost of installing an electric pump is generally compared to the cost of a solar heating system. The annual cost of electricity to run a heat pump could be two thirds of the cost of natural gas or one-third the cost of electricity for conventional resistance electric heater, but the sun's energy is free. The cold swimming pool is mostly used only in summer and remains unused during the harsh winters. The implementation of solar pool heaters is cost effective and enhances the enjoyment of swimming and also adds value to the home. Proper sizing and installation along with quality product are primary concerns when considering a solar heater for the pool. Solar pool heaters are an investment.
